For examples of `generic', user-level SCSI programming on Linux, I
recommend that you take a look at Juergen P. Meier's
<jor@muecke.rz.fh-muenchen.de> utility on sunsite called 'unload.' It
shows how to fill in the appropriete fields in a request and pipe it down
to a device file. I am not an expert on SCSI or Linux/SCSI programming,
but the little I have done was greatly facilitated by this example.
